General Hessite Information

Help on Chemical  Formula: Chemical Formula: Ag2Te
Help on Composition: Composition: Molecular Weight = 235.47 gm
   Silver     45.81 %  Ag
   Tellurium  54.19 %  Te
             ______ 
             100.00 % 
Help on Empirical Formula: Empirical Formula: AgTe
Help on Environment: Environment: Moderate to low temperature veins.
Help on IMA Status: IMA Status: Valid Species (Pre-IMA) 1843
Help on Locality: Locality: Calaveras, Nevada Link to MinDat.org Location Data.
Help on Name Origin: Name Origin: Named after the Swiss chemist, G. H. Hesse (1802-1850).
Help on Synonym: Synonym: ICSD 73230
  PDF 34-142
  Telluric Silver

Hessite Crystallography

Help on Axial Ratios: Axial Ratios: a:b:c =1.8147:1:1.8058
Help on Cell Dimensions: Cell Dimensions: a = 8.13, b = 4.48, c = 8.09, Z = 5; beta = 112.9° V = 271.43 Den(Calc)= 7.20
Help on Crystal System: Crystal System: Monoclinic - PrismaticH-M Symbol (2/m) Space Group: P 21/c
Help on X Ray Diffraction: X Ray Diffraction: By Intensity(I/Io): 2.31(1), 2.87(0.8), 2.25(0.7),

Physical Properties of Hessite

Help on Cleavage: Cleavage: [100] Indistinct
Help on Color: Color: Lead gray, Steel gray.
Help on Density: Density: 7.2 - 7.9, Average = 7.55
Help on Diaphaniety: Diaphaniety: Opaque
Help on Fracture: Fracture: Uneven - Flat surfaces (not cleavage) fractured in an uneven pattern.
Help on Habit: Habit: Euhedral Crystals - Occurs as well-formed crystals showing good external form.
Help on Habit: Habit: Granular - Generally occurs as anhedral to subhedral crystals in matrix.
Help on Hardness: Hardness: 1.5-2 - Talc-Gypsum
Help on Luminescence: Luminescence: None.
Help on Luster: Luster: Metallic
Help on Magnetism: Magnetism: Nonmagnetic
Help on Streak: Streak: light gray
 

Optical Properties of Hessite

Help on RL Anisotrophism: RL Anisotrophism: Distinct, dark orange to dark blue.
